| commit | 6005bd821c0fe1290a5aaa1f00d6a6c762724f53 | [log] [tgz] |
|---|---|---|
| author | Fariborz Jahanian <fjahanian@apple.com> | Fri Feb 26 22:49:11 2010 +0000 |
| committer | Fariborz Jahanian <fjahanian@apple.com> | Fri Feb 26 22:49:11 2010 +0000 |
| tree | 0be08ceaaf7c76036c43c684085b8fe61954ae85 | |
| parent | be730c9e34b115328559c4776156d60c7b7bee5c [diff] [blame] |
Prevent rewriter crash when variable type is missing. Fixes radar 7692183. llvm-svn: 97281
diff --git a/clang/test/Rewriter/rewrite-byref-in-nested-blocks.mm b/clang/test/Rewriter/rewrite-byref-in-nested-blocks.mm index c6279de..a8f5b14 100644 --- a/clang/test/Rewriter/rewrite-byref-in-nested-blocks.mm +++ b/clang/test/Rewriter/rewrite-byref-in-nested-blocks.mm
@@ -13,10 +13,13 @@ @implementation X - (void)foo { __block int kerfluffle; + // radar 7692183 + __block x; f(^{ f(^{ y = 42; kerfluffle = 1; + x = 2; }); }); }